PARKER Parker 2H-150903120812632 Description Description Parker 46599558 50.8CJ2HGL14MC300.000M1100 Related products Parker HMI-111108143800782 Parker 024-31936-001 Parker PV270R1L1LLNMRW Parker 054-34281-000 Parker 024-90555-000 Parker S24-10871-4